Yb1Ni5 is an intermetallic compound in the ytterbium-nickel system, representing a rare-earth metal alloy that combines ytterbium's unique electronic properties with nickel's structural stability. This material is primarily of research and development interest rather than established in high-volume production, with potential applications in thermoelectric devices, magnetic materials, and electronic components where rare-earth intermetallics offer advantages in low-temperature physics and quantum material studies. The compound's notable characteristic is the combination of ytterbium's strong electron-phonon coupling behavior with nickel's transition-metal d-band contributions, making it relevant to materials scientists exploring advanced functional materials rather than traditional structural engineering applications.
